Maybe I'm just a perfectionist anal motherfucker when it comes to software code efficiency but, I don't think adding stutterbox and the security features or boost gauge mods are a good idea.They require branches to subroutines, which takes extra time to execute, and the majority of the ecu code is time dependant.So the subroutines add microseconds(doesn't sound like much, but it is) to the program loop, which changes things, I can't say for sure it changes things in a bad way, but it does change things(not accounted for by mitsu engineers who wrote the original firmware).The only harmless subroutine is the octane reset, because it only executes once per power reset.Todd Day may have investigated this further, but I doubt keydiver did, since his chips were out within days of him figuring out the eprom.Anyway I'll do them, but I don't recommend them.
